  • the present invention relates to a switch for grooved rails or rut constituted by a profiled cradle forming the housing of a movable deflection needle, as well as the rolling and guide surfaces and allowing the installation of the means necessary for the operation of the needle.
  • the invention relates more particularly, without being limited thereto, to switches for urban transport or port facility railways, the rails of which are embedded in the surface of the road network.
  • Patent LU 87.503 proposes a new method for manufacturing switches of the type described above and according to the preamble of the appended single claim, which is entirely carried out by machining exclusively by chip removal. This method of manufacturing switches has many advantages, one of the most important of which is that it can be performed automatically under programmed control.
  • the object of the present invention is to provide an improved switch which has all the advantages of the switch obtained according to the aforementioned Luxembourg patent but which, in addition, allows an improvement in the yield and a significant reduction in machining waste.
  • the invention relates to a referral according to the appended single claim.
  • the machining time of such a switch is significantly reduced, which increases the production capacity.
  • the heat treatment before the assembly of the constituent parts is easier.
  • Reconditioning is also easier, in particular by replacing the needle rail after wear.
  • the size of the steel blocks required for machining can also be reduced.
  • Figure 1 shows a pair of rails 10, 12 which are extended by a switch 14 for guiding a convoy, either on the pair of rails 10a, 12a, or on the pair of rails 10b, 12b.
  • the switch works in a conventional manner, only its manufacturing process and, consequently, the profile of the parts used is distinguished from the state of the art. This is illustrated by the different sections according to Figures 2 to 6.
  • Figure 2 shows a cross section of a referral cradle 16 at the point of a needle 18.
  • the cradle is formed by a body 20 and a needle rail 22 , bolted to each other, in several places using bolts 23.
  • the body 20 is produced in accordance with the method proposed by patent LU 87.503, that is to say, by machining, preferably, by automatic milling under programmed control.
  • the needle rail 22 to which the body 20 is bolted may be formed by rail 10, 10a or rail 12, 12b of the existing track or by a rut rail welded to the latter.
  • the needle-guide rail 22 has its rut 24 as shown in FIGS. 5 and 6, while in the part of the switch where the needle 18 is movable to exercise its deflection functions, the rail 22 is devoid of its rut as shown in Figures 2 to 4.
  • the head of rail 22 defines with an appropriate profile of the body 20 produced by milling a groove forming the housing of the needle 18.
  • the needle rail 22 is also devoid of the foot adjacent to the body 20 to allow bolting of the latter on the rail 22.
  • the removal of the foot of the rail 22 and its rut 24 can be made by milling or sawing.
  • the invention therefore makes it possible to reduce a non-negligible part of the machining proposed in the aforementioned patent by taking advantage of the existence of the counter-needle rail 22, the operation of removing the rut 24 and the base of the rail being largely offset by the gain in machining.
  • the machined body 20 may have, as in the aforementioned patent, an inner longitudinal groove, not shown, for the passage of the heating pipe.
  • Figures 3 and 4 correspond to the same figures of the aforementioned patent and respectively show a vertical hole 28 through the body 20 for the evacuation of rainwater and rinsing and a horizontal bore 30 intended to receive the maneuvering means of the needle 18.
  • Figure 5 shows a section at the end of the switch in the region where the needle 18 is wider and where it is connected to the rails of the track.
  • Figure 6 shows a section at the junction with the rail 10b which, in order to be bolted to the body 20 and to the needle rail 22 is also devoid of its foot on the side adjacent to the body 20.
  • the raw material for the production of the body 20 is a rolled, forged or molded bloom, the quality of the steel of which can be easily determined by the manufacturer of the switch. These blooms are preferably cut lengthwise and obliquely so as to be able to produce, using a single bloom, two referral bodies 20 in application of the teaching provided by the aforementioned patent. After machining, it is possible to subject the body 20 to a heat treatment, or to localized quenching to achieve surface hardening of the parts most exposed to stresses. It is also possible to perform surface reloading by welding to locally increase the resistance. In the event of wear of the needle rail 22, it is possible to cut the latter, to unbolt it from the body 20 and to replace it without requiring replacement of the body 20.

Weiche für Rillenschienen, aus einer Profilwiege, die den Sitz einer beweglichen Abzweigungs-Leitzunge (18), sowie die Lauf- und Führungsflächen bildet, wobei die Profilwiege einen Durchbruch (30) aufweist, der die Anbringung der Mittel ermöglicht, die zur Betätigung der Weiche erforderlich sind, und die Profilwiege einen Teil aufweist, der eine Leitzungen-Gegenschiene (22) und einen durch spanabhebende Bearbeitung verwirklichten Profilkörper (20) bildet, dadurch gekennzeichnet, daß die Leitzungen-Gegenschiene (22) aus einer Rillenschiene (22) besteht, die auf den Profilkörper (20) aufgeschraubt ist, wobei bei dieser Rillenschiene der Schienenfuß auf der zu dem Profilkörper (20) hin gerichteten Seite über die gesamte Länge des Profilkörpers entfernt wurde, um die Verschraubung zu ermöglichen, und bei dieser Rillenschiene die Rille (24) in dem Teil der Weiche entfernt wurde, in dem die Leitzunge (18) beweglich ist, um ihre Abzweigungsfunktion zu erfüllen.
